Your dealer is incorrect.... (IF you have the security group package)
the reason they are staying on, is to let you know that the alarm is NOT activated
Try opening the drivers door, press the door lock button once, then just shut the door (do not use the key fob for this check)
This mode of "Manuely Locked - Arm Alarm" is how the security system works
Read the owners manuel on how to activate the alarm system,
as ther is a brief description in there about it.
After doing this, the LED mirror/puddle lights should shut off very quickly

SUBJECT:
Flash: Exterior Mirror Courtesy Lamps Stay On Longer Than The Customer Desires.
OVERVIEW:
This bulletin involves flash reprogramming front Door Control Modules with new software.
MODELS:
2010-2011 (DS) Ram Truck (1500 Pick Up)
2010-2011 (DD) Ram Truck (3500 Cab Chassis)
2010-2011 (DJ) Ram Truck (2500 Pick Up)
2010-2011 (DX) Ram Truck (Reg Cab Chassis)
2010-2011 (D2) Ram Truck (3500 Pick Up)
**2011 (DP) Ram Truck (4500/5500 Cab Chassis)**

NOTE: This bulletin applies to vehicles equipped with Exterior Mirror Courtesy
Lights (sales code LEC) built between August 24, 2009 (MDH 0824XX) and
December 13, 2010 (1213XX).

NUMBER:
08-003-11 REV. A
GROUP:
Electrical
DATE:
February 24, 2011
SYMPTOM/CONDITION:
The Exterior Mirrors Courtesy Lamps may stay lit longer then the courtesy lighting time out
(after the interior courtesy lights have shut off).
